Recently, a photo has been released of a man somewhere between 25 and 40 years of age, wearing black pants, a black shirt, and a red tie, who is wanted in connection with 2 separate incidents of fondling young girls in the San Leandro Walmart and Target stores. The man evidently approached 2 girls in a local Walmart store and touched one of them inappropriately before running away. Then, it is suspected that he headed to a nearby Target in Bayfair Center and proceeded to do the same thing to another girl there. Surveillance cameras in the stores recorded both incidents and stills of the man are available to view online for identification.
California Penal Code 288 (“Lewd Acts with a Child”) covers not only what is more commonly known as ‘child molestation,’ but the inappropriate touching of any child by an adult. This law defines inappropriate touching as touching that occurs for the purposes of sexual gratification. It could mean that an adult touches a child in an unacceptable way, even the touching or fondling occurs over clothing and not in private areas of the body. If the suspect is arrested and charged of child molestation, there will be severe penalties.
If the child in question is under the age of 14, then penalties may include up to 8 years in state prison. However, there are sentencing enhancements in the case of force being used (10 years) or if a pattern of 3 or more incidences emerges during the course of the investigation (up to 16 years).
